Numerical Determination of the Initial Condition in Cauchy Problems for a Hyperbolic Equation with a Small Parameter

Abstract

Numerical methods are proposed for determining the initial condition in Cauchy problems for a hyperbolic equation with a small parameter multiplying the highest-order derivative. Additional information for the inverse problem is provided by the solution of the Cauchy problem specified at x = 0 as a function of time. Results of numerical calculations illustrating the potential of the proposed method are reported.
